1
est 2016-08-04 09:40:35 +08:00
做 spark 就学 scala 。其余的没有必要。
|
2
BMW 2016-08-04 09:42:32 +08:00 via iPhone
还是学 java 吧
|
3
knightdf 2016-08-04 09:44:53 +08:00
java+python 法力无边, scala 我只写 spark
|
4
wander2008 2016-08-04 09:49:53 +08:00 via iPhone
居然在这里问区别…
|
6
skydiver 2016-08-04 10:04:46 +08:00 via Android
应该问这两个有什么共同点么
|
7
maomaomao001 2016-08-04 10:05:11 +08:00 via Android
@ideaplat 那就用 kotlin 吧
|
8
21grams 2016-08-04 10:05:20 +08:00
这两个有什么好比的? 八杆子扯不着吧
|
9
mko0okmko0 2016-08-04 11:35:12 +08:00
听起来就是个新手问题,
就假设你是想自学来解决自己的问题好了. python 很适合新手,因为社群健壮,提问基本上都有人回答. scala 基本上就是另一种 JAVA,性能比 python 好但社群??? scala 基本上最重要的核心就是 AKKA,但 AKKA 也可单独拆出来用于 JAVA 和延伸语言例如 kotlin . scala /kotlin 等 JAVA 延伸语言的好处:没有 JAVA 版本问题,没有 python 版本问题. 其实 C#也是很不错的. 再好的语言没有社群你要自己搞,应该会很快就放弃或失败.你先找社群吧.语言不是问题. |
10
Perry 2016-08-04 11:41:14 +08:00
po 主你 python 还没学好就别来问有没有必要学 scala 了
|
11
huanghua123 2016-08-04 11:53:53 +08:00
scala 是函数式语言 python 不是
|
12
caixiexin 2016-08-04 12:37:52 +08:00 via Android
主要语言是 Java ,再接触 JVM 语言才有亲切感。。不然等着被 sbt 虐吧😂
|
13
wmttom 2016-08-04 13:31:23 +08:00
学 Scala 可以发现更大的世界,之后会感觉其他语言的特性都不会太陌生,感觉尤其是函数式编程和类型系统。
不过身边会 Scala 的都是搞 spark 的,或者曾经搞过 spark 的。 如果 Scala 都精通了,学 Python 也就是看下语法熟练下的事。 Scala 与函数式编程是信仰,如果面试遇到信仰相同的面试官可能有加分。 |
14
wh0syourda66y 2016-08-23 16:29:53 +08:00
学 scala 之前,可以先看看 haskell ,再学起来会轻松不少
|